Moving in Urmston
Looking for removals in Urmston? Hello Services runs man-and-van, full house removals, packing, office moves and long-distance relocations across M41 with crews based inside Trafford. 1930s semis with bays and drives, Victorian terraces and modern closes. That stock is what decides the crew size and the van: a stair carry out of a converted upper floor is not the same job as a driveway load, and we do not price it as though it were.
Completion days rarely run to plan, which is why every Urmston removal is sequenced around the key release, with secure overnight hold available if the chain slips. Parking and permits are cleared with Trafford Council in advance.

Access, parking and timing
1930s semis with bays and drives, Victorian terraces and modern closes. That stock, the street it sits on and the Trafford Council rules over it decide how long the day takes — so all three are settled at survey, not on the morning.
Driveway loading makes these moves efficient. What moves the price is the loft, the garage and the shed, so the survey deliberately opens all three. Crews run from Trafford, so Davyhulme and Timperley journeys carry no out-of-area charge.
The crew should be carrying, not circling. We confirm the restriction type on the M41 end, arrange a suspension through Trafford Council where it is worth it, and plan the closest legal standing point to the door. Fixed bands, quoted before we start. What moves the price is access, stair turns, parking distance and the size of the job — not the postcode you live in.
| Package | What it covers | Price |
|---|---|---|
| 2 bed house or flat | One van, two crew, most of a day. | from £395 |
| 3 bed house | Large van, three crew, full day with dismantling. | from £595 |
| 4+ bed house | Two vans, four crew, survey-led fixed price. | from £895 |
Includes protection materials, dismantling and reassembly, and goods-in-transit cover. Packing is quoted separately.
